What Makes the Sharp Carousel Countertop Microwave Stand Out?

At the core of the Sharp Carousel series lies its signature feature: the Carousel turntable system. This rotating plate is fundamental to achieving even heating and cooking, eliminating the frustrating “cold spots” often found in non-turntable models. By continuously rotating your food, the Carousel ensures that microwave energy is distributed uniformly, leading to more consistent and delicious results whether you’re reheating leftovers or cooking a full meal. Key Features and Specifications Across the Sharp Carousel Range

The Sharp Carousel lineup is diverse, catering to various kitchen sizes and cooking needs. While specific models vary, several key features are consistently highlighted:

  • Capacity & Power: Sharp Carousel microwaves are available in a range of capacities, typically from compact 0.9 cubic feet to spacious 2.2 cubic feet. Correspondingly, their power output usually spans from 900 watts to a robust 1200 watts. This range allows consumers to choose a model that perfectly aligns with their household size and cooking frequency. A larger capacity is ideal for families or those who frequently cook larger dishes, while smaller units are perfect for individuals or limited counter space.
  • Inverter Technology: Many Sharp Carousel models boast Inverter technology, a significant advancement in microwave cooking. Unlike traditional microwaves that cycle power on and off, Inverter technology delivers a consistent, controlled stream of microwave energy. This results in more evenly cooked food, better texture preservation, and superior defrosting without cooking the edges while the center remains frozen. It essentially offers a more nuanced and gentle cooking process.
  • Sensor Cooking: This intelligent feature takes the guesswork out of cooking. Sensor cook models automatically adjust cooking time and power levels based on the humidity released by the food. Simply select the food type, and the microwave does the rest, ensuring optimal results for anything from popcorn to baked potatoes without you needing to monitor it.
  • Pre-set Menus & One-Touch Controls: Convenience is paramount, and Sharp Carousel microwaves deliver with a variety of pre-set menus for popular foods like pizza, beverages, and fresh vegetables. One-touch express cooking buttons allow for quick starts (e.g., “Add 30 Seconds” or instant minute settings), streamlining everyday tasks.
  • Design & Aesthetics: The series often features sleek stainless steel finishes, which provide a modern and premium look that complements most kitchen décors. Alongside this, clear LED displays offer easy readability, and intuitive control panels ensure simple operation for users of all experience levels.

Performance Analysis: Heating, Defrosting, and More

When it comes to real-world performance, Sharp Carousel microwaves generally receive high marks for their core functions:

  • Even Heating: Thanks to the Carousel turntable and often the Inverter technology, food is heated more thoroughly and evenly than many competitors. This means fewer cold spots in your dinner and consistent warmth from edge to center.
  • Defrosting Accuracy: The Inverter technology, combined with sensor defrost functions, excels at thawing frozen items gently and uniformly. This prevents the common issue of cooked edges and still-frozen centers, allowing for better food preparation.
  • Cooking Speed: With wattages up to 1200W, many Sharp Carousel models offer rapid cooking and reheating times, making them highly efficient for busy households. The higher the wattage, the faster the cooking process.
  • User Experience: The control panels are typically intuitive, featuring clearly labeled buttons and easy-to-read displays. While some users might find the initial programming a slight learning curve, the convenience of sensor cooking and one-touch options quickly becomes a favorite feature.

Choosing the Right Sharp Carousel for Your Kitchen

Selecting the ideal Sharp Carousel microwave involves aligning its features with your lifestyle:

  • Consider Capacity: For a single person or small apartment, a 0.9 to 1.1 cu. ft. model might suffice. A family of four or more would benefit from a 1.6 to 2.2 cu. ft. model to handle larger plates and casserole dishes.
  • Power Needs: If speed is a priority, opt for models with 1100W or 1200W. If energy efficiency is a greater concern and you don’t mind slightly longer cooking times, a 900W model could be suitable.
  • Specific Features: Evaluate if Inverter technology, sensor cooking, or specific pre-set menus are essential for your cooking habits. These features significantly enhance convenience but may increase the price.
  • Budget: Sharp Carousel microwaves are generally available across various price points, offering good value for money. Compare features across models within your budget to find the best balance.

Maintenance and Longevity Tips

To ensure your Sharp Carousel microwave remains a reliable kitchen ally for years:

  • Cleaning Stainless Steel: Use a damp microfiber cloth with a mild stainless steel cleaner or simply warm, soapy water. Always wipe in the direction of the grain to avoid streaks and preserve the finish.
  • General Interior Care: Regularly wipe down the interior with a damp cloth and mild detergent to prevent food splatters from hardening. For stubborn stains, a mixture of lemon juice and water, microwaved for a few minutes, can help loosen grime. Always ensure the turntable is clean and seated correctly.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Do not use abrasive cleaners or scouring pads, as they can scratch the interior and exterior surfaces.
  • Proper Venting: Ensure the microwave has adequate clearance around its vents for proper airflow, which helps prevent overheating and extends its lifespan.

How does inverter technology benefit microwave cooking?

Inverter technology provides a continuous, consistent stream of microwave power at all settings, unlike traditional microwaves that cycle full power on and off. This results in more even cooking, better food texture, and more thorough, gentle defrosting without cooking the edges, making for superior overall cooking results.
